Our Heather Collection

IMG_0993.jpeg
Calluna Vulgaris (The Classic)

This traditional variety rewards you with late-summer blooms. It thrives in open ground or garden planters.

Erica Carnea (Winter Heath)

A hardy variety that brightens your garden from winter to spring. Its delicate bells provide a splash of pink and white while other plants rest. Perfect for rock gardens or adding texture to the front of your borders.

Daboecia (St. Dabeoc’s Heath)

Elegant bell-shaped flowers that shine from summer through autumn. Known for glossy leaves and lovely beds.

Erica Cinerea (Bell Heather)

A vibrant, mounding plant that bursts into flower during the warmer months. Its deep purple and pink tones stand out against dark green leaves. An excellent choice for sun-drenched garden spots or decorative pots that need a bold pop of hardy colour.

Erica Darleyensis (Spring)

Dependable and long-lasting blossoms that appear from late winter onwards. These are wonderful for attracting hungry bees early in the season to your home garden.
